New rules for scrap metal dealers
From today it will be illegal for scrap merchants to pay cash for metal. There's also an increase in fines for offenders.

Eighteen people have been arrested during morning raids as police clamp down on metal theft in Essex.
In a joint operation with British Transport Police, officers from the Kent & Essex Serious Crime Directorate executed search warrants at nine scrap metal yards across the county including Witham, Chelmsford, Basildon and Southend.
As well as recovering a quantity of items, including stolen property officers have so far arrested 18 people in connection with theft and the handling of stolen property.
